Main Characters and Their Development

  • William Halloway - A thirteen-year-old boy, one of the two main protagonists. William is thoughtful and cautious. Throughout the book, he undergoes many trials that help him understand the importance of friendship and bravery. His relationship with his father, Charles Halloway, also plays a crucial role in his development, strengthening their mutual understanding and trust.
  • Jim Nightshade - William's best friend, also a thirteen-year-old boy. Jim is more impulsive and prone to taking risks. His desire to grow up and explore the unknown leads him into dangerous situations. Over the course of the book, Jim learns to appreciate his life and friendship with William, realizing that growing up doesn't always bring the desired results.
  • Charles Halloway - William's father, a librarian. He feels old and useless, but throughout the book, he finds the strength and courage to stand against evil. His wisdom and love for his son help him overcome inner fears and become a true hero.
  • Mr. Dark - The main antagonist, the owner of the sinister carnival. He embodies evil and uses people's fears and desires to manipulate them. Mr. Dark represents the force that the main characters must fight to save themselves and their town.
  • Miss Foley - A teacher who becomes a victim of the carnival. Her desire to regain her youth leads to tragic consequences. Her story serves as a warning that desires can be dangerous if they are based on illusions.
